Yellow Jackets Edge Wolverines, 13-8, in JV Football Action
Greer High School sophomore Cameron Ferguson prepares to catch a pass from junior Ahmad Mattison Thursday night at Dooley Field.
September 16, 2016
GREER — The Greer High JV Football Team got a second-half touchdown from freshman wide receiver Cameron Martin to edge Woodruff High School, 13-8, Thursday night at Dooley Field.
Trailing 8-6, Martin took the snap from the “wildcat” formation and ran for the touchdown. Freshman kicker Deybi Reyes booted the extra point to give the Yellow Jackets the 13-8 advantage.
Woodruff got on the board first with a touchdown from its running back. Greer High School sophomore running back A.J. Bolden tied the game at 6-6 with a touchdown in the second quarter.
The Wolverines took an 8-6 lead in the second half after a snap sailed over the head of Martin and went through the end for a safety.
The Yellow Jackets (2-2) will have a bye week next and will travel to Travelers Rest High School on Thursday, September 29. The game is scheduled to kickoff at 7:00 p.m.
